メインコンテンツへスキップ
サービス一覧

Web・モバイル開発

最先端技術で構築するフルスタックのWebおよびモバイルアプリケーション。

カスタムソフトウェア開発

すべてのビジネスには、既製のソフトウェアでは完全に対応できない固有の課題があります。当社のカスタムソフトウェア開発サービスは、お客様のワークフロー、ビジネスロジック、成長軌道に正確に沿ったソリューションをオーダーメイドで作成します。ステークホルダーと密接に連携して要件を理解し、エレガントで保守性の高いコードに変換します。

社内ツールや管理ダッシュボードから顧客向けプラットフォームやSaaS製品まで、実際の課題を解決するアプリケーションを構築します。当社の開発プロセスではクリーンアーキテクチャ、包括的なテスト、ドキュメンテーションを重視し、ビジネスの進化に合わせてソフトウェアが保守・拡張可能であることを保証します。

複雑なデータ処理、リアルタイムインタラクション、大規模同時接続ユーザーを処理する高性能アプリケーションを専門としています。当社のエンジニアリングチームは、フィンテック、Eコマース、ヘルスケア、教育、物流を含む複数の分野にわたる専門知識を有しています。

フロントエンドとバックエンド

当社のフロントエンド開発はNuxtとVueを中心に、高速でアクセシブル、SEOフレンドリーなWebアプリケーションを構築しています。最適なパフォーマンスと検索エンジン可視性のためにサーバーサイドレンダリングを行い、ハイドレーションによりリッチなインタラクティブ体験を提供します。レスポンシブでアクセシブルな、ピクセルレベルまでこだわったインターフェースを設計しています。

バックエンドでは、RustとAxumフレームワークがAPI・サービス構築の主要技術です。Rustはガベージコレクションなしでメモリ安全性を実現し、極めて高速かつ信頼性の高いシステムの構築を可能にします。迅速なプロトタイピングや特定のエコシステム統合が求められるプロジェクトでは、Node.js、Go、Pythonも使用しています。

当社のデータベースアーキテクチャは、リレーショナルデータにPostgreSQL、キャッシングとリアルタイム機能にRedis、要件に応じて専用データベースを活用しています。パフォーマンスを考慮したスキーマ設計を行い、本番ワークロード向けに適切なインデックス、クエリ最適化、コネクションプーリングを実装します。

モバイルソリューション

共有コードベースでネイティブパフォーマンスを実現するクロスプラットフォーム技術を用いてモバイルアプリケーションを開発しています。当社のアプローチにより、iOSとAndroid全体で一貫した高品質な体験を確保しながら、開発時間とコストを削減します。

より深いプラットフォーム統合が必要なアプリケーションでは、カメラ、生体認証センサー、NFC、Bluetoothなどのデバイスハードウェアとインターフェースするネイティブモジュールを開発します。当社のモバイルソリューションには、オフラインファーストアーキテクチャ、プッシュ通知、ディープリンク、バックエンドサービスとのシームレスな同期が含まれます。

私たちのプロセス

当社の開発プロセスは、2週間スプリント、定期的なデモ、継続的インテグレーションによるアジャイル原則に従っています。まずディスカバリーフェーズで要件定義、ユーザーストーリーの作成、技術アーキテクチャの確立を行います。この基盤により、ビジネス目標と技術実装の整合性を確保します。

開発期間を通じて、定期的なスタンドアップ、スプリントレビュー、プロジェクト管理ツールへのアクセスにより透明性のあるコミュニケーションを維持します。コード品質は、自動テスト、コードレビュー、各コミットでリンティング、型チェック、テストスイートを実行する継続的インテグレーションパイプラインによって担保されます。

デプロイメントはブルーグリーンデプロイメントやカナリアリリースなどのゼロダウンタイム戦略により自動化されています。初日から包括的な監視とアラートを設定し、ユーザーに影響が及ぶ前に問題を検出・解決します。

NuxtVueTypeScriptRustAxumPostgreSQLRedisDockerNode.jsGo

よくある質問

フロントエンドにはNuxtとVue、バックエンドにはRustとAxumを使用し、PostgreSQLをデータベースとして採用しています。プロジェクトの要件や既存のインフラに応じて、React、Node.js、Go、Pythonも使用しています。

2週間スプリント、デイリースタンドアップ、定期的なスプリントレビューを含むアジャイル手法を採用しています。完全な透明性のためにプロジェクト管理ツールへのアクセスを提供します。開発サイクル全体を通じて、定期的な進捗報告とデモを行います。

はい。バグ修正、セキュリティアップデート、パフォーマンス監視、機能拡張を含む保守パッケージを提供しています。サポートチームが24時間体制でアプリケーションを監視し、合意されたSLAの時間枠内で重大な問題に対応します。

始める

プロジェクトをお考えですか?クリーンなコードと丁寧なデザインで実現をお手伝いします。無料相談はお気軽にご連絡ください。

お問い合わせ